Design Hybrid Framework Using Selenium Maven Testng

Asked by: Lasandra Stukenborg
asked in category: General Last Updated: 7th June, 2020

What is a hybrid framework?

What is a Hybrid Framework? Hybrid Driven Framework is a combination of both the Data-Driven and Keyword-Driven framework. Here, the keywords, as well as the test data, are externalized.

Hybrid is a combination of 2 or more automation frameworks. For example, I had designed a Hybrid framework combining Data Driven and Method-Driven Frameworks. Now you need to explain why you need individual Framework. ie. why you need Data Driven Framework/Testing in your application.

Beside above, what are frameworks in selenium? Selenium Framework is a code structure that helps to make code maintenance easy. Using Frameworks, produce beneficial outcomes like increased code re-usage, higher portability, reduced script maintenance cost, higher code readability, etc.

Also question is, what is hybrid framework in selenium?

Hybrid Test framework is a concept where we are using the advantage of both Keyword and Data-driven framework. Here for keywords, we will use Excel files to maintain test cases, and for test data, we can use data, provider of TestNG framework.

Is Selenium a framework?

Selenium is a portable framework for testing web applications. Selenium provides a playback tool for authoring functional tests without the need to learn a test scripting language (Selenium IDE).

33 Related Question Answers Found

Is cucumber a framework?

Cucumber is one such open source tool, which supports behavior driven development. To be more precise, Cucumber can be defined as a testing framework, driven by plain English text. It serves as documentation, automated tests, and a development aid – all in one. Not every BDD framework tool supports every tool.

Is TestNG a framework?

TestNG is a testing framework for the Java programming language created by Cédric Beust and inspired by JUnit and NUnit. The design goal of TestNG is to cover a wider range of test categories: unit, functional, end-to-end, integration, etc., with more powerful and easy-to-use functionalities.

What are the different types of frameworks?

The Frameworks Are Available: Linear Scripting Framework: Modular Testing Framework: Data-driven Framework: Keyword Driven Testing Framework: Hybrid Driven Testing Framework: Behavior Driven Development Testing Framework:

What is Maven Selenium?

Maven is a build management tool, it helps to manage selenium projects making smoothly. Maven not provides some extra functions to write selenium test cases. it's a build management tool and it manages selenium test projects make build compilation, documentation and other project tasks. Maven used POM.

What is framework with example?

Framework. A framework, or software framework, is a platform for developing software applications. A framework may also include code libraries, a compiler, and other programs used in the software development process. Several different types of software frameworks exist. Popular examples include ActiveX and .

What are different types of automation frameworks?

Types of Test Automation Frameworks: Linear Scripting Framework. Modular Testing Framework. Data Driven Testing Framework. Keyword Driven Testing Framework> Hybrid Testing Framework. Behavior Driven Development Framework.

How do you test an API?

API Testing Best Practices: Test for the expected results. Add stress to the system by sending series of API load tests. Group API test cases by test category. Create test cases with all possible inputs combinations for complete test coverage. Prioritize API function calls to make it easy to test.

What is POM model in selenium?

Page Object Model is a Design Pattern which has become popular in Selenium Test Automation. It is widely used design pattern in Selenium for enhancing test maintenance and reducing code duplication. A page object is an object-oriented class that serves as an interface to a page of your Application Under Test(AUT).

Is TestNG data driven framework?

TestNG is a framework that makes data-driven testing possible in selenium. TestNG is a testing framework created in line with Junit but with added features that makes it suitable for use in regression test automation projects.

What is keyword framework?

Keyword Driven Framework is a type of Functional Automation Testing Framework which is also known as Table-Driven testing or Action Word based testing. The basic working of the Keyword Driven Framework is to divide the Test Case into four different parts.

What is TestNG framework?

TestNG is an automation testing framework in which NG stands for "Next Generation". TestNG is inspired from JUnit which uses the annotations (@). Using TestNG you can generate a proper report, and you can easily come to know how many test cases are passed, failed and skipped.

What is Selenium Grid?

Selenium Grid is a part of the Selenium Suite that specializes in running multiple tests across different browsers, operating systems, and machines in parallel. Selenium Grid has 2 versions - the older Grid 1 and the newer Grid 2.

What is automation framework?

Framework approach in automation. A test automation framework is an integrated system that sets the rules of automation of a specific product. This system integrates the function libraries, test data sources, object details and various reusable modules.

Design Hybrid Framework Using Selenium Maven Testng

Source: https://askinglot.com/what-is-a-hybrid-framework

0 Response to "Design Hybrid Framework Using Selenium Maven Testng"

Publicar un comentario

Iklan Atas Artikel

Iklan Tengah Artikel 1

Iklan Tengah Artikel 2

Iklan Bawah Artikel